THE ATHLETE ASSISTANCE FUND INC, founded in 2018, is a micro nonprofit that reported $8K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 158%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$438K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 5574% operating deficit.

Mission

THE MISSION OF THE ATHLETE ASSISTANCE FUND IS TO MAKE COUNSELING SERVICES AVAILABLE TO ANY CURRENT OR FORMER USA GYMNASTICS MEMBER GYMNAST WHO SUFFERED SEXUAL ABUSE WITHIN THE SPORT OF GYMNASTICS BY CONFIDENTIALLY CONNECTING ATHLETES TO SKILLED HEALTHCARE PROVIDERS FOR APPROPRIATE TREATMENT THROUGH AN INDEPENDENT THIRD-PARTY ORGANIZATION. THE ATHLETE ASSISTANCE FUND ALSO CONDUCTS EDUCATIONAL WORKSHOPS AND DEPLOYS CURRICULUM AND TRAINING TO EMPOWER ATHLETES, PARENTS, COACHES AND GYM OWNERS REGARDING STRATEGIES TO DECREASE THE RISK OR THREAT OF SEXUAL ABUSE AND TO PREVENT ABUSE AND INCREASE THE SAFETY OF ALL GYMNASTS.
